Keeping on the camping store theme, how does a camping store get customers like Jack?

Some customers are better than others.

Why spend your precious marketing $ on a customer who'll come in once and spend $5 when, with a bit of targeting, you can get to kids like Jack who spend heaps, come back every week and are a source of referrals for you?

Here's 2 easy ways:

1. Make an offer to the local Scout Troop: donate gear, donate some money, offer the use of some trial gear, take an ad next to the Scout Hall. That would get to kids like Jack.

2. Make a deal with a camping place: you'll display their brochures if they display yours. Maybe get the camping grounds to provide a value added "Thanks for camping" pack that offers camping tips, free resources and special offers in your camping place. That would get to kids like Jack.

Not all customers are created equal. Business success is much surer if you find the 'best' customers.
